dross Posted June 18 Share Posted June 18 A developer that was helping me with a plugin sent me a video showing some errors on my site. I happened to notice that while he was logged into my site, there were four different view options in the upper right corner. I've tried all the browsers, and I don't see this as an option anywhere. Is there something I'm missing? Please see attached screenshot. Thanks so much. Link to comment
paul2009 Posted June 18 Share Posted June 18 (edited) These buttons are added by the Squarewebsites PRO Tool (a paid Chrome extension) but I believe SquareKicker has something similar. There isn't a tablet view built into Squarespace and i don't think they are likely to add one until Fluid Engine has a tablet breakpoint or similar solution.
